The Winnipeg Jets Should Retool Now

The Winnipeg Jets need to start the retool now and not in the off-season-

In a year that has gone off the rails, it makes sense to me to start the retooling right now. 

Retool ~ Verb

1.  equip with new or adapted tools.
2.  adapt or alter to make them more useful or suitable.

The good guys are currently sitting at 18-17-7 going in the NHL’s All-Star break which puts them 6th in the Central Division and the news gets worse.  The Jets sit 9 points out of the last wildcard position and need to jump over five teams with only fourty games left in the season.  Even the most diehard fan knows there is no way in hell with the way this team is playing from the goaltender out that we will see a Whiteout this season.  Let’s call it what it is, another lost season and move on.  I know, I know the truth hurts but I’m not here to wave pom-poms or blow smoke you know where.
